Transaction 27424ab69bcfb1916c36d1a1d07492f94f2ef0170b3c36baf8c9b16201d8039f

1 Input
2 Outputs
  • 27424ab69bcfb1916c36d1a1d07492f94f2ef0170b3c36baf8c9b16201d8039f:0
  • value  138000
    address  14hSHmqSfNpnDfFksFYNAoGpzNZf3ocm69
  • 27424ab69bcfb1916c36d1a1d07492f94f2ef0170b3c36baf8c9b16201d8039f:1
  • value  58882502
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C